England vs Egypt: Wayne Rooney To Miss International Friendly?

49 views 3 March 2010

Wayne Rooney - EnglandManchester United playmaker and forward Wayne Rooney is likely to miss England’s international friendly match against Egypt tonight at the Wembley Stadium.

England will be playing the defending African champions as a preparation for the 2010 World Cup tournament in South Africa in June this year, but a minor knee injury received during the English Carling Cup final match between Manchester United and Aston Villa could rule out Wayne Rooney.

Rooney is however hoping for the best, and speaking to the press about the pressure around him ahead of this match, he said:

“I don’t feel any pressure or burden… really.

“To be honest, I have probably had pressure since I was 16, so it is something you get used to, and deal with in your own way.”

Wayne Rooney scored the winning goal for Manchester United against Aston Villa in the Carling Cup final at the Wembley Stadium on Sunday afternoon.
